François b36af3167a Extract load into core (app::load_module); thin the command.
Move the import orchestration — System::Load + drop_singleton_signals +
infer_signal_types + the post-import counts — out of the `load` command into
core/app/load.{hpp,cpp}: app::load_module(System*, name, path, ImportType)
returns a LoadResult (ok/error, parts, signals, dropped, power/gnd/kept_other)
with no Print/dialog/FTXUI. The "mentor|altium|ods" string→enum mapping moves
to app::import_type_from_name (mirrors export_format_from_path). The command
only parses the type and renders the counts; output is byte-identical.

Add tests/test_load.cpp (core, no UI): the name mapping; a minimal Mentor
netlist that imports two parts and drops one singleton signal; and a pin test
of the pre-existing missing-file behaviour (ImportBase doesn't check is_open(),
so a missing file yields an empty module rather than an error — preserved by
the extraction and pinned so any future hardening is a deliberate change).
